The SM6T220CA-E3/52 belongs to the category of TVS (Transient Voltage Suppressor) diodes.
It is used for surge protection in various electronic circuits and systems to safeguard against voltage spikes and transients.
The SM6T220CA-E3/52 is typically available in a surface-mount package, which facilitates easy integration onto circuit boards.

The SM6T220CA-E3/52 operates based on the principle of avalanche breakdown, where it rapidly conducts when the voltage across it exceeds the breakdown voltage. This effectively diverts the excess energy away from the protected circuitry.
The SM6T220CA-E3/52 finds extensive use in various applications, including: - Consumer electronics - Telecommunications equipment - Industrial control systems - Automotive electronics - Power supplies
